Lawsuit Mesothelioma

A victim of mesothelioma can file a lawsuit against asbestos manufacturers. To receive the highest amount of compensation, victims must hire a mesothelioma lawyer.

The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are settled outside of the court. This process takes less time and offers an assurance of compensation. Mesothelioma lawsuits that don't settle may go to trial.

The majority of mesothelioma cases are settled without trial. Trials are costly and time-consuming. Even if a defendant wins in court, they may lose on appeal. This can delay payouts by years.

Settlements for mesothelioma lawsuit settlement amounts can differ in their value. The strength of the case and jurisdiction can impact the award. The severity and stage of the disease can also play a role. The type of asbestos used can play a significant role in the outcome of the lawsuit.

The mesothelioma litigation process usually expedited because the disease progresses rapidly and patients require financial support immediately. A mesothelioma lawyer is capable of overcoming the strategies employed by large corporations to avoid paying compensation. This includes filing appeals with frivolous arguments that can delay the resolution.

Wrongful death claims are a kind of mesothelioma lung cancer lawsuit lawsuit that is filed on behalf of a loved one who died as the result of asbestos exposure. The person who files this claim is usually a representative appointed by the probate court. The representative is appointed on behalf of the estate of the deceased individual. The lawsuit may be amended to include a claim for wrongful death after the asbestos victim passes away.

In most personal injury lawsuits, there is a statute of limitation that defines the time frame for which the family member or victim have to pursue legal action. Mesothelioma cases also have a statute of limitation. However the length of time frame varies based on the state and the type of claim. Mesothelioma claims may be filed as personal injury or a wrongful death lawsuit.

Personal injury claims are filed by the victim or their family members, whereas the wrongful death lawsuits are filed by the victims' heirs. The timeframe for filing mesothelioma claims is based on several different aspects, such as the date of diagnosis and the location where the victim was exposed to asbestos.

It is essential to speak with a lawyer who is experienced in asbestos litigation as soon as possible. The statute of limitation is often a challenge when filing a mesothelioma suit. A lawyer who is experienced in asbestos litigation can help you file a mesothelioma lawsuit and ensure that all deadlines are met.

Many asbestos-related lawsuits have been filed against businesses who have reorganized themselves under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ection in order to avoid the payment of asbestos-related costs. The companies have established trust funds to provide compensation for victims. However, the statutes of limitations for trust fund claims and class-action lawsuits may be different than those for personal injury or wrongful death lawsuits.
